Output 803a90efc34a1b46689c82efe577b7070768b56300dfd3a5aced09a0224be4ba:0

value
87964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b2a72feb0bece7e0afe6e3f4865b097a59ad3d OP_EQUAL
address
3Dswp6CZZPCB2dc86uvfpATNbSTQfHfkjC
transaction
803a90efc34a1b46689c82efe577b7070768b56300dfd3a5aced09a0224be4ba
spent
true